History of the “Himalayan Healers” project
The Himalayan Healers project is the only massage therapy school in the world that was designed specifically to provide professional massage therapy training to those who are considered “Untouchable” in India and Nepal. This vision soon expanded to include training for any and all of need, particularly those who experienced some form of trauma (be it human trafficking, domestic abuse, or generational trauma in a variety of forms). By providing 500 hours of professional massage therapy training to our students they were able to free themselves from their emotional pain and scars, to regain a healthy sense of touch, and to move forward as powerful, positive, confident individuals in the world. Over 8 years more than 150 Nepalis of profound need were trained and employed, dramatically changing their lives – and the lives of those around them – for the better.
As both Founder and primary Funder of the project, Rob Buckley worked for 8 years to build the Himalayan Healers platform. He also worked on an entirely volunteer basis. In late 2012 it was time to pass the torch, and the Himalayan Healers platform was handed over to local management and direction, with 8 spa boutiques and a training center for the local team to manage as “Himalayan Healers of Nepal”. We truly wish them the greatest success in their ongoing efforts.

Massage School in Nepal
One of the primary goals of The Giving Touch platform is to continue to raise awareness and funds for the effort to build the Himalayan Healers massage therapy school in Nepal. Despite significant social success in Nepal over the past 8 years, the financial success required to build a massage school has yet to manifest. The Himalayan Healers organization in USA will continue to promote and support these efforts. A further support will be direct contributions from The Giving Touch massage school in Colorado.
The vision for the massage school is simple:
1. Rather than wasting funds on the purchase of incredibly expensive land in Nepal (which also brings with it the question of ownership) a 20 year local lease will be requested from local Nepali communities, with a target of Manang as the likely location. In exchange for building a massage school and community center we will request that we are able to operate massage therapy trainings rent free for 20 years, at which point the land and building will be handed over to the local community or school for oversight and implementation.
2. This greatly reduces the initial expenses required to achieve our goal, and is also more of a true community benefit.
3. The building itself will have a simple design that allows for multiple uses and functions. Suggested combined uses include: mini-library, tutoring center, health clinic, community hall, and of course, massage training center. A needs-resources analysis will be conducted prior to construction to ensure community interest and benefit are maximized.

Job Placements
Another primary goal of the Giving Touch platform and it’s efforts to help facilitate job placement for Himalayan Healers of Nepal graduates, students, and staff. Over the past 8 years we have declined far more opportunities than we have accepted, with a primary focus upon arranging safe employment outside of Nepal. Four Seasons Resorts has worked with us on numerous occasions, and we hope to build upon and expand on those links and opportunities.
Both customized as well as standard training protocols can be developed as per the employers needs, while qualified, ambitious, positive Nepalis of need can be recruited to provide extremely skilled and loyal staff.
